Well, it is an old old tradition..not necessarily this day but often around this time of year....we have done it in the context of Vietnam veterans but it is for everyone....many ancient traditions, including Aztecs, Druids, did stuff like this at this time of year...tomorrow is Day of the Dead in Mexico..All Saints Day today for Catholic, all souls tomorrow...(when the souls get released from purgatory if you pray hard enough..some of them..it is like an early release program I believe). I chose the particular day because we lost track of the Watchfires program that seemed to have rotating days...too hard to remember what day it is. Today was also the birthday of a childhood friend killed in Vietnam. mg
